Baby Box Offers 'Safe Haven' for Abandoned Newborns

About 150 babies in the United States are abandoned each year in creeks, along roadsides and in trash cans, according to child advocates.  One such baby was a newborn girl, found off a snowy trail in an Indianapolis, Indiana, park.  Linda Znachko, whose ministry buries abandoned infants, named the baby Amelia Grace Hope. She believes Amelia didn’t have to die. That's because there was a Safe Haven location not far from where Amelia was found.  A safe space...
